From the land of the Bluenose.....well for the 2nd time in 33 years at this hobby I got kicked out of an area.  Apparently I wondered out of the park onto private property. <center>[img width= height=]http://im1.shutterfly.com/procserv/47b6cf03b3127cce8f3c10dd201400000016108AcM2bhk4ZN2[/img]</center> .  I apologized and promptly left.  Darn was a good spot too as I picked up half the day's quota in what was her backyard.  Such is life. Son of a seahorse!

Did a tactical retreat to the kloof on the other side of the lake and took in the view <center>[img width= height=]http://im1.shutterfly.com/procserv/47b6cf03b3127cce8f3c10cea13700000016108AcM2bhk4ZN2[/img]</center> before heading into the wooded area and becoming one with the trees and hill...a mountain goat in other words.  This was a good thing as the first coin here was a 1967 silver macheral dime followed by a ton of bottle caps.<center>[img width= height=]http://im1.shutterfly.com/procserv/47b6cf03b3127cce8f3c10c0a13900000016108AcM2bhk4ZN2[/img]</center>.

Had about enough of slipping and sliding after about 45 minutes so hit another park close by and picked up a first for this bouy...a 20 cent Spanish Euro coin.  Almost had the big one as I first thought it was a gold coin.

Time was running out way too soon as the "boss" had to be picked up and due on shift for the other  boss at 1700 hrs.  Man if it moves call it sir and salute it.

Total for the day was the 1967 silver macheral, euro and 59 coins @ $4.77<center>[img width= height=]http://im1.shutterfly.com/procserv/47b6cf03b3127cce8f3c10cca13500000016108AcM2bhk4ZN2[/img]</center>
